| ⇢ | A | DummyPluginFile added |
| ⇢ | B | PluginsService::copyDummyPlugin() added | |
| ⇢ | A | DummyPluginFile::rename() added | |
| ⇢ | A | PluginsController::copyDummyPlugin() added | |
| ⇢ | A | DummyPluginFile::getName() added | |
| ⇢ | A | DummyPluginFile::__construct() added | |
| ⇢ | A | DummyPluginFile::getContent() added | |
| ⇢ | A | WebsiteCore::getOptionsJSON() added | |
| ⇢ | A | DummyPluginFile::isLocal() added | |
| ⇢ | A | DummyPluginFile::getPermissions() added | |
| ⇢ | A | DummyPluginFile::getParent() added | |
| ⋮ | view more | ||
| C | ↗ | B | PicoController::getAsset() improved |
| C | ↗ | B | PicoController::getPage() improved |
| A | ↛ | MiscService::consumeException() removed | |
| A | ↘ | B | js/admin.js got worse |